Subject: [PATCH v7 10/12] rpmsg: char: Introduce the "rpmsg-raw" channel
Date: Mon, 8 Nov 2021 15:19:35 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20211108141937.13016-11-arnaud.pouliquen@foss.st.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20211108141937.13016-1-arnaud.pouliquen@foss.st.com>
Allows to probe the endpoint device on a remote name service announcement,
by registering a rpmsg_driverfor the "rpmsg-raw" channel.
With this patch the /dev/rpmsgX interface can be instantiated by the remote
firmware.

diff --git a/drivers/rpmsg/rpmsg_char.c b/drivers/rpmsg/rpmsg_char.c
index 6a01e8e1c111..dd754c870ba1 100644
--- a/drivers/rpmsg/rpmsg_char.c
+++ b/drivers/rpmsg/rpmsg_char.c
@@ -432,6 +432,58 @@ int rpmsg_chrdev_eptdev_create(struct rpmsg_device *rpdev, struct device *parent
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(rpmsg_chrdev_eptdev_create);
+static int rpmsg_chrdev_probe(struct rpmsg_device *rpdev)
+{
+ struct rpmsg_channel_info chinfo;
+ struct rpmsg_eptdev *eptdev;
+ struct device *dev = &rpdev->dev;
+
+ memcpy(chinfo.name, rpdev->id.name, RPMSG_NAME_SIZE);
+ chinfo.src = rpdev->src;
+ chinfo.dst = rpdev->dst;
+
+ eptdev = rpmsg_chrdev_eptdev_alloc(rpdev, dev);
+ if (IS_ERR(eptdev))
+ return PTR_ERR(eptdev);
+
+ /*
+ * Create the default endpoint associated to the rpmsg device and provide rpmsg_eptdev
+ * structure as callback private data.
+ * Do not allow the creation and release of an endpoint on /dev/rpmsgX open and close,
+ * reuse the default endpoint instead
+ */
+ eptdev->default_ept = rpmsg_create_default_ept(rpdev, rpmsg_ept_cb, eptdev, chinfo);
+ if (!eptdev->default_ept) {
+ dev_err(&rpdev->dev, "failed to create %s\n", chinfo.name);
+ put_device(dev);
+ kfree(eptdev);
+ return -EINVAL;
+ }
+
+ return rpmsg_chrdev_eptdev_add(eptdev, chinfo);
+}
+
+static void rpmsg_chrdev_remove(struct rpmsg_device *rpdev)
+{
+ int ret;
+
+ ret = device_for_each_child(&rpdev->dev, NULL, rpmsg_chrdev_eptdev_destroy);
+ if (ret)
+ dev_warn(&rpdev->dev, "failed to destroy endpoints: %d\n", ret);
+}
+
+static struct rpmsg_device_id rpmsg_chrdev_id_table[] = {
+ { .name = "rpmsg-raw" },
+ { },
+};
+
+static struct rpmsg_driver rpmsg_chrdev_driver = {
+ .probe = rpmsg_chrdev_probe,
+ .remove = rpmsg_chrdev_remove,
+ .id_table = rpmsg_chrdev_id_table,
+ .drv.name = "rpmsg_chrdev",
+};
+
static int rpmsg_chrdev_init(void)
{
int ret;
@@ -442,12 +494,24 @@ static int rpmsg_chrdev_init(void)
return ret;
}
+ ret = register_rpmsg_driver(&rpmsg_chrdev_driver);
+ if (ret < 0) {
+ pr_err("rpmsg: failed to register rpmsg raw driver\n");
+ goto free_region;
+ }
+
return 0;
+
+free_region:
+ unregister_chrdev_region(rpmsg_major, RPMSG_DEV_MAX);
+
+ return ret;
}
postcore_initcall(rpmsg_chrdev_init);
static void rpmsg_chrdev_exit(void)
{
+ unregister_rpmsg_driver(&rpmsg_chrdev_driver);
unregister_chrdev_region(rpmsg_major, RPMSG_DEV_MAX);
}
module_exit(rpmsg_chrdev_exit);
